What We Do:

Cybercrime is growing, and more businesses are getting hit by threats that used to target only the biggest organizations. That pushes defenders like us to operate at the highest level, and it deepens our need for good people who want to make a meaningful impact.

Founded in 2015 by former NSA cyber operators, Huntress is a remote-first team working to make enterprise-grade cybersecurity accessible to businesses of all sizes. We work closely with security teams and service providers protecting complex environments, often without the time or headcount to handle it all. That’s why we build our technology in-house and back it with a 24/7 human-led Security Operations Center (SOC). As a result, our platform is never disconnected from the experts who manage it, ensuring our customers' protection.

Huntress now secures more than 5M endpoints and 14M identities worldwide. Those numbers keep growing because more businesses rely on us to help carry the load and operate with more confidence. What You’ll Do: 

We are looking for a highly motivated and collaborative Channel Sales Engineer to serve as the primary technical advisor for regional resellers, VARs and Distributors. You will work hands-on with their sellers and technical teams, educating them on the value of the Huntress platform, and building their confidence to sell and deploy our solutions. This is a consultative, high-touch role where you act as an extension of their team, helping them grow their business by improving their ability to position, demonstrate, and support the Huntress Managed Security Platform.

Responsibilities:  

  • Equip regional resellers and VAR teams with the technical knowledge and skills needed to sell, deploy, and support Huntress solutions through frequent hands-on training sessions, workshops, and product demonstrations.
  • Deliver demonstrations to resellers and their customers and show the Huntress value.
  • Serve as the primary technical advisor for our reseller sellers and VARs.
  • Act as a day-to-day liaison between regional resellers and VARs and Huntress product teams, providing clear feedback on customer needs, feature gaps, and recurring trends.
  • Build and maintain tactical sales collateral (decks, demos, battle cards) that help regional resellers and VARs articulate Huntress value in the field.
  • Onboard new resellers and VARs to the Huntress platform, including NFR environments and demo setups.
  • Support regional events, roadshows, and joint customer engagements that drive pipeline and close business.
  • Ability to travel ~50% of the time to meet with customers and attend tradeshows and events.
